Phantoms/Lock Monsters recap for Sunday, February 15, 2004
Philadelphia Phantoms 2, Lowell Lock Monsters 1
========================================
LOWELL, MA -- P.J. Stock scored on a second-period penalty shot to help the
Philadelphia Phantoms down the Lowell Lock Monsters, 2-1, on Sunday. Stock beat
goaltender Patrick DesRochers with 4:47 remaining in the middle stanza for his
first game-winner of the season. Randy Jones contributed a power-play goal and
Neil Little stopped 27 shots for Philadelphia, which snapped a three-game
losing skid. DesRochers ended with 22 saves in defeat. Damian Surma netted his
third goal of the year for Lowell, which has lost three straight.
